โ€ข Understanding Kindness and its Importance in Schools – This unit will cover the definition and benefits of kindness, as well as the role it plays in creating a positive school environment. โ€ข Building a Kindness Foundation – This unit will focus on the key elements of a culture of kindness, including empathy, respect, and inclusivity. โ€ข Creating a Kindness Action Plan – In this unit, participants will learn how to create a plan that promotes kindness and addresses unkind behavior in the school community. โ€ข Kindness in Practice – This unit will provide practical strategies for promoting kindness, including role-playing exercises, group discussions, and community service projects. โ€ข Implementing a Kindness Curriculum – This unit will cover how to incorporate kindness into the school curriculum, including lesson plans and resources. โ€ข Measuring Kindness – This unit will discuss methods for measuring the impact of kindness initiatives in schools, including surveys and anecdotal evidence. โ€ข Overcoming Obstacles to Kindness – This unit will address common challenges to creating a culture of kindness, such as bullying and harassment, and provide strategies for overcoming them. โ€ข Engaging Parents and the Community – This unit will explore ways to involve parents and the wider community in promoting a culture of kindness in schools. โ€ข Sustaining a Culture of Kindness – In this final unit, participants will learn how to maintain and build upon a culture of kindness in the school community.
